LINUX.ORG.RU

Gentoo fbsplash + проприетарный драйвер nVidia...


0

1

Доброго времени суток. Вопрос в следующем: делал fbsplash с компиляцией initramfs непосредственно в ядро по этому http://gentoo.theserverside.ru/gentoo-doc/Gentoo_doc-1.5-24.html мануалу. Использовал vesafb. Ядро собиралось без проблем, появлялся фон в консоли, но при установке проприетарного драйвера nVidia вылетала ошибка связанная с nvidia.ko и, соответственно, драйвер не устанавливался. Где-то слышал о конфликтах (framebuffer,fbsplash) c проприетарным драйвером nvidia. Сталкивался ли кто-нибудь с подобным? Стоит ли заморачиваться с решением?

зы: Собирал ядро на виртуалке, соответственно с «виртуалбоксовским» видеодрайвером, - проблем не было.

Заранее благодарен.


Ответ на: комментарий от megabaks

ERROR: Unable to load the kernel module 'nvidia.ko'. This happens most frequently when this kernel module was built against the wrong or improperly configured kernel sources, with a version of gcc that differs from the one used to build the target kernel, or if a driver such as rivafb, nvidiafb, or nouveau is present and prevents the NVIDIA kernel module from obtaining ownership of the NVIDIA graphics device(s). Please see the log entries 'Kernel module load error' and 'Kernel messages' at the end of the file '/var/log/nvidia-installer.log' for more information. -> Kernel module load error: insmod: error inserting './usr/src/nv/nvidia.ko': -1 Invalid parameters -> Kernel messages: fbcondecor: switched decor state to 'on' on console 0 nvidia: module license 'NVIDIA' taints kernel. Disabling lock debugging due to kernel taint nvidia: no symbol version for agp_bind_memory nvidia: Unknown symbol agp_bind_memory (err -22) nvidia: no symbol version for agp_enable nvidia: Unknown symbol agp_enable (err -22) nvidia: no symbol version for agp_backend_acquire nvidia: Unknown symbol agp_backend_acquire (err -22) nvidia: no symbol version for agp_bridges nvidia: Unknown symbol agp_bridges (err -22) nvidia: no symbol version for i2c_del_adapter nvidia: Unknown symbol i2c_del_adapter (err -22) nvidia: no symbol version for agp_free_memory nvidia: Unknown symbol agp_free_memory (err -22) nvidia: no symbol version for agp_allocate_memory nvidia: Unknown symbol agp_allocate_memory (err -22) nvidia: no symbol version for agp_unbind_memory nvidia: Unknown symbol agp_unbind_memory (err -22) nvidia: no symbol version for i2c_add_adapter nvidia: Unknown symbol i2c_add_adapter (err -22) nvidia: no symbol version for agp_copy_info nvidia: Unknown symbol agp_copy_info (err -22) nvidia: no symbol version for agp_backend_release nvidia: Unknown symbol agp_backend_release (err -22) ERROR: Installation has failed. Please see the file '/var/log/nvidia-installer.log' for details. You may find suggestions on fixing installation problems in the README available on the Linux driver download page at www.nvidia.com.

SEVA
() автор топика
Ответ на: комментарий от SEVA

Написано же ж: Внимание: Новый режим - LORCODE

>nvidia: no symbol version for agp_bind_memory nvidia: Unknown symbol agp_bind_memory (err -22)
Ну кагбе опять же очевидно написано: наконпелял ядро без поддержки agp, да?

anon_666
()
Ответ на: комментарий от amorpher
fads@extensa ~ $ zcat /proc/config.gz | grep AGP
# CONFIG_AGP is not set
fads ★★
()
Ответ на: комментарий от anon_666

Поддержка [/dev/agpgart (AGP Support)] собиралась и модулем и в ядре.

SEVA
() автор топика
Ответ на: комментарий от frak

На момент установки драйвера: /lib/modules/2.6.36-gentoo-r5/video/nvidia.ko

SEVA
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.